Resources like HealthSherpa.com and Healthcare.gov can help you find out whether you … WebMar 9, 2024 · What is the IPT rate in Spain The current IPT rate in Spain is 8%, as of 2024 and is applied to all classes of insurance, with some exemptions. Classes exempt from IPT include life, health, reinsurance, group pensions, export credit, suretyship, goods and passengers in international transit, agricultural risks, aviation and marine hull insurance.

WebMay 30, 2024 · Insurance Premium Tax (IPT) is a tax on general insurance premiums, introduced by Kenneth Clarke in the 1993 Budget. Since its introduction, IPT has become a contentious topic as the standard rate was originally set at 2% but it has increased steadily and incrementally year on year.
